What is RTP?
RTP represents the percentage of all wagered money that a slot machine returns to players over time. For example, a slot with 96% RTP means that for every $100 wagered, the game theoretically returns $96 to players. The remaining 4% represents the house edge.
Why RTP Matters
Choosing slots with higher RTP percentages gives you better long-term odds. Most regulated online casinos offer slots ranging from 94% to 98% RTP. While this doesn’t guarantee individual wins, it affects your expected value across numerous spins.

Important Considerations
Remember that RTP is calculated over millions of spins, not individual gaming sessions. You might win big on a 94% RTP slot or lose on a 98% one—short-term results vary significantly.
